Verified Commit 257228f0 authored by Camil Staps's avatar Camil Staps 🙂

Fix WebAssembly copy_from_string for large records without pointers

parent 33263da4
......@@ -1721,7 +1721,7 @@
(local.set $arity (i32.sub (local.get $arity) (i32.const 1)))
(call $copy
(i32.add (local.get $hp) (i32.const 24))
(i32.add (local.get $s) (local.get $i))
(i32.add (local.get $s) (i32.add (local.get $i) (i32.const 8)))
(local.get $arity))
(local.set $i (i32.add (local.get $i) (i32.shl (local.get $arity) (i32.const 3))))
